Setup campaign member statuses that will be applied whenever campaigns are created or the record type or campaign type changes. Add specific sets of statuses that can apply to particular record types and campaign types in any combination.

Ascend is the most comprehensive, end to end solution for fundraising and constituent engagement, built natively on Salesforce - and continues to push the boundaries of what is possible in the areas of next generation constituent experiences and AI.
